I am going to work as a member in practice overseas - can I do this if registered?

Answer

You must hold a practicing certificate if you are going to undertake practice work, either in the UK or overseas.

However, it is important that you familiarise yourself with the local legislation regarding accountancy work and take the appropriate professional indemnity insurance to ensure you are covered for any problems that may arise.

It is also important that you ensure you are competent in the work undertaken. Further guidance is available in CIMA's code of ethics.
